In today’s digital age, having a mobile application has become a prerequisite for many businesses aiming to expand their reach and enhance customer engagement. Whether you’re a start-up or an established enterprise, the decision to create a mobile app involves selecting the right development partner. This crucial choice often boils down to opting between an App Development Company and a Mobile App Development Company.
Let’s delve into the distinctions between these two entities and explore which might align better with your specific app development needs.
Understanding the Differences
App Development Company:
An App Development Company typically focuses on crafting applications across various platforms, including mobile, web, and desktop. These companies often specialize in creating software solutions that cater to a broad spectrum of devices and operating systems. Their expertise lies in creating versatile applications that can adapt seamlessly to diverse platforms, ensuring a consistent user experience across devices.
Mobile App Development Company:
On the other hand, a Mobile App Development Company specializes primarily in designing and building applications specifically for mobile devices. They possess in-depth knowledge and expertise in mobile platforms like iOS, Android, and hybrid app development. These companies concentrate on leveraging the unique features and functionalities of mobile devices to create tailored, high-performing mobile applications.
Factors to Consider
-
Project Scope and Complexity:
If your project involves multi-platform development, including mobile, web, and potentially desktop, partnering with an App Development Company might be more suitable. They can handle the complexities of creating a cohesive experience across various platforms seamlessly.
For a mobile-centric project where your primary focus is on creating an exceptional mobile app, a Mobile App Development Company might offer more specialized skills and insight into maximizing the mobile user experience.
-
Expertise and Specialization:
App Development Companies often have broader expertise, encompassing diverse technologies and platforms. This breadth of knowledge might be advantageous if your project requires comprehensive solutions beyond mobile platforms.
Conversely, a Mobile App Development Company typically possesses a more concentrated skill set specifically tailored for mobile app development. Their specialization might result in more refined and optimized mobile applications.
-
Budget and Resources:
Consider your budget and resource allocation for the project. App Development Companies might charge differently based on the complexity of multi-platform development, potentially impacting your budget.
Mobile App Development Companies, with their focus on mobile-specific solutions, might offer more cost-effective options. For creating high-quality mobile applications within a defined budget.
Making the Choice
When deciding between an App Development Company and a Mobile App Development Company, it’s crucial to evaluate your project requirements, budget constraints, and the level of expertise needed.
For a Comprehensive Solution: If your project demands a multi-platform approach or requires a versatile solution, an App Development Company might be the better choice.
For Mobile-Centric Projects:
If your primary goal is to develop a top-notch mobile application with a strong emphasis on user experience and platform-specific features. A Mobile App Development Company might be the ideal fit.
Conclusion
Both Mobile App Development Company bring unique strengths to the table. Choosing the right partner depends on the specific needs and goals of your project. Assessing the scope, expertise, and budget constraints will help you make an informed decision, ensuring. The successful development of your mobile application in alignment with your objectives.